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Chemical Engineering, Food Engineering, Pharmaceutical Chemistry, Chemistry, or a related field
- Advanced English proficiency (written and spoken)
- Strong communication skills, both written and verbal
- Experience working independently with minimal supervision and ability to seek guidance when needed
- Experience participating in or leading projects
- Experience developing and delivering training materials
- Strong computer skills, including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el) and web-based applications
- Familiarity with tools such as Power BI, Salesforce, SAP, Intelex, or TraceGains
- Detail-oriented with strong analytical and problem-solving skills
- Proactive and capable of identifying innovative solutions
- Strong time management and organizational skills
- Effective communicator with the ability to collaborate across teams
- Customer-focused mindset

Location: Guadalajara Workplace type : Hybrid As an Associate, Global Quality Documentation , you will support the implementation and continuous improvement of systems and processes used by the Global Quality Documentation team, contributing to operational excellence and effective knowledge management across the organization. What will you do: Support the implementation and improvement of Global Quality Documentation systems and processes Assist in the development and delivery of training for new systems and procedures Create and maintain training materials, schedules, and documentation records Support knowledge management initiatives by identifying and addressing training needs Act as a key contributor to global documentation-related projects Provide professional and timely customer support, ensuring a positive experience in every interaction
